3.3.0 - Compatibility release
In order to improve compatibility with older versions of PHP as well as future versions of PHP, this release uses a different set of classes to implement node types depending on the PHP version. The base classes are those created directly in the s9e\SweetDOM namespace, and only those classes should be used when checking for class types.
Backward compatibility with older versions of PHP
On PHP older than 8.1.23, and on PHP versions from 8.2.0 to 8.2.9, the following methods are emulated:
ChildNode::afterChildNode::beforeChildNode::replaceWithParentNode::appendParentNode::prepend
Forward compatibility with future versions of PHP
The following methods have been modified to match PHP 8.3's behaviour with regards to disconnected nodes (nodes with no parent) and align with the DOM specification.
ChildNode::afterChildNode::beforeChildNode::replaceWith

3.2.0
This version adds a polyfill for Element::replaceChildren() which is available in PHP 8.3.0. There is currently no plans to add a similar polyfill to other implementors.

3.1.0
This version adds support for batch operations via document fragments. For example:
$dom = new s9e\SweetDOM\Document;
$dom->loadXML('<x/>');
$x = $dom->firstOf('//x');
$x->appendDocumentFragment(
// The callback will be executed before the fragment is appended
fn($fragment) => $fragment->appendXML('<y/><z/>')
);
echo $dom->saveXML($x);<x><y/><z/></x>3.0.1

3.0.0
Full Changelog: 2.1.2...3.0.0
This is a major update with a number of deprecations. See UPGRADING.md for a conversion guide.
New features:
- Magic methods now support the following DOM operations:
after,append,before,prepend, andreplaceWith. - Support for magic methods and XPath methods has been extended to more classes. See README.md for a list of classes.
s9e\SweetDOM\Documenthas a new$nodeCreatorproperty that can be used to extend the range of nodes that can be created by magic methods.
